Prep and Cook ‍Time

Preparation: 15 ‍minutes | ⁤ Cooking: 30-40 minutes ⁢|⁢ Total: 45-55 minutes

Yield

Serves 4 as a ‍hearty‌ side ‍dish

Difficulty Level

Easy – Perfect for both beginner and ​seasoned home cooks

Ingredients

  • 2 cups baby carrots, peeled⁢ and⁤ trimmed
  • 1 ‌large ‌red ‌bell pepper, cut ‍into‍ 1-inch pieces
  • 1 medium zucchini, sliced into ⁣thick​ half-moons
  • 1 cup Brussels⁣ sprouts, halved
  • 1 large red onion, cut‍ into⁣ wedges
  • 3 tbsp extra-virgin olive oil
  • 1 ½ tsp sea salt
  • ½ ‌tsp freshly ground ⁢black ⁢pepper
  • 1 tsp smoked paprika
  • 1 tsp dried thyme or fresh⁣ sprigs
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tbsp balsamic ⁣vinegar‌ (optional, for finishing)

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ven ⁤to 425°F (220°C). Line a large baking sheet‍ with parchment paper or ‍a silicone mat ​for easy cleanup ‌and‍ even ⁤heat ‍distribution.
  2. Prepare the ⁢vegetables ⁢by washing and ‍cutting them into uniform sizes to ensure even roasting. Smaller pieces⁣ will crisp up nicely,‌ while thicker cuts retain a⁢ tender bite.
  3. In‌ a large⁣ mixing bowl, ‌combine the vegetables​ with olive oil, salt, pepper, smoked paprika, thyme, and minced garlic. toss⁣ thoroughly until ‍every piece is evenly coated ⁤and glistening.
  4. Arrange ​the vegetables in⁣ a ‍single layer on the baking sheet, leaving space ⁣between pieces to allow hot air to circulate-this is key to developing ⁣those coveted crispy edges.
  5. Roast in the oven for 30 to‌ 40 minutes, ⁣turning the vegetables halfway​ through.⁤ Look for deep caramelization and ‌golden-brown tips,⁤ especially on the carrots ⁤and Brussels sprouts.
  6. Optional: In⁤ the ⁤last 5 minutes, drizzle with balsamic‌ vinegar and toss gently​ to add a tangy sweetness that ⁢balances the savory notes.
  7. Remove from the oven and ⁣let rest for ​a few‌ minutes to allow the flavors‍ to ⁢meld and⁣ the vegetables to firm slightly.
  8. Serve⁤ warm, garnished with⁢ fresh herbs like parsley or a​ sprinkle ⁤of toasted pine ‌nuts for added⁢ texture.

Tips for Success

  • Vegetable choice matters: Root ⁤vegetables ‍like carrots and sweet potatoes have ​high natural‍ sugars that caramelize beautifully, while cruciferous veggies⁢ add savory earthiness.
  • Consistent sizing ensures even cooking-cut‍ thicker‌ vegetables like ⁢zucchini and ‌onion into ‌larger chunks and keep ⁤delicate greens smaller but grouped separately⁣ if needed.
  • For⁣ crispy edges, ⁣ avoid overcrowding your baking sheet. Use two pans if necessary to ⁢maintain ​plenty⁤ of airflow.
  • Adjust ⁤seasoning to your taste. A ‌touch of cayenne⁤ or cumin adds warmth, while fresh lemon zest brightens the dish⁤ instantly.
  • Oven variability: ‍Check‌ vegetables early in​ convection ovens as they cook faster;⁤ reduce⁤ temperature by⁤ 25°F if using a toaster ​oven ⁤or smaller appliance.
  • Make ahead: Pre-cut and⁤ toss your veggies​ in oil ‌and seasoning ​the⁢ night ‍before-store tightly covered in the fridge ​and roast straight from⁢ cold.

Q1:​ Why is ​roasting considered⁣ the magical method for cooking vegetables?
A1: ​Roasting vegetables is ⁢like unlocking a ⁣secret door to ​flavor paradise. The high, dry heat caramelizes the natural sugars in vegetables, creating a deep, rich flavor profile that steaming ‍or⁢ boiling simply can’t⁢ match. It’s where humble veggies transform into ​golden, crispy-edged bites ⁢of pure joy.

Q2: Which vegetables are the‌ stars of roasting?
A2: While ‍nearly any vegetable can⁣ be roasted,the champions include root vegetables like​ carrots,sweet potatoes,and⁢ beets,as well ‍as cruciferous ⁤beauties⁢ like cauliflower​ and​ Brussels sprouts.Their​ sturdy texture holds ⁣up to roasting’s intense heat,‍ developing crispy outsides and tender, melt-in-your-mouth insides.

Q3: What’s the secret ⁣to‌ achieving the ⁤perfect roast?
A3: ‍The magic lies in balance: the right temperature (usually around 400°F ‌to 425°F), uniform cutting to ensure even cooking, and the perfect⁣ coating of​ oil‍ and seasoning. Don’t overcrowd your‍ pan-air circulation is‍ key ⁣for that⁣ coveted crispy edge. And, ‌of course, patience to let your⁤ veggies reach that golden state without rushing.

Q4:‍ How do I make my roasted vegetables burst with flavor?
A4: Infuse ⁤your veggies with personality⁢ by tossing them in ⁤aromatic‍ oils, herbs, and ‍spices before roasting. Think garlic,rosemary,thyme,paprika,or even​ a​ dash ⁢of ‌smoked chili powder. ⁤Finish with⁤ a sprinkle​ of sea salt and⁣ a squeeze ⁢of fresh lemon​ juice ‍or ​a drizzle of ⁣balsamic glaze for an enchanting flavor crescendo.

Q5: Can​ roasting vegetables be healthy, ⁢or ⁣dose‌ oil ruin ⁣that?
A5: Roasting is ⁢wonderfully ⁤healthy! Using a modest amount of heart-healthy oils like ⁣olive oil enhances nutrient absorption, especially fat-soluble vitamins, without tipping ⁢the scales. plus,​ roasting ⁢preserves⁢ more nutrients compared to boiling,‍ which can leach vitamins into the water.

Q6: What’s a common‌ pitfall to avoid when​ roasting vegetables?
A6: the ‍most ​common slip-up​ is overcrowding ⁢the ⁢pan. When veggies ⁢are packed too tightly, ​they steam rather ⁢than roast, yielding soggy, limp⁤ results. Give them room to breathe ⁢and roast in a single layer for that crisp, caramelized magic.

Q8: Is ​there a way to make roasting faster without ⁢sacrificing flavor?
A8: ‍absolutely! Cutting vegetables into⁢ smaller, ⁣uniform pieces ‌speeds up cooking ⁤and increases surface ⁣area ‍for⁢ caramelization.‍ Preheating ⁣your ⁣baking sheet in the⁣ oven ‌before adding veggies can also jump-start the crisping process. But ‌remember-good things take‌ time, so⁢ don’t‍ rush the​ final golden glow.

Q9: How can I store ⁣and reheat‌ roasted vegetables without losing their⁤ magic?
A9: Store ⁤leftovers in an​ airtight ‍container⁣ in the fridge. To reheat, spread them out ‍on ‌a baking sheet ⁢and pop them in a hot ‍oven⁤ (around 375°F) for 10 ⁣minutes ‍to revive‌ crispiness. Avoid the⁢ microwave if you want to preserve that enchanting texture.
